Over-the-top "mad scientist" spoof stars Steve Martin as Dr. Michael Hfuhruhurr, the World's best brain surgeon who ends-up falling for Kathleen Turner when he accidently hits her with his car. Little does he realize that she's really just a money grubber who's out for his cash. Along the way he falls for a talking brain in a jar (voiced by Sissy Spacek) and has to try and figure out a way they can be together.
With tons of wacky humour, this entertaining time gives Martin (who co-wrote) the chance to ham it up bigtime and he takes full advantage. There's lots of witty laughs on hand, Turner is perfect as the "tease" wife and despite the tepid "love story" they try and make between Martin and the brain and an extremely silly finale this is a totally watchable black comedy.
Look closely and you'll see B-movie favourite Jeffrey Combs in an early role (and in one of the funniest bits of the movie involving "shaving").
The best moment here involves the identity of the "Elevator Killer". Martin and director Carl Reiner teamed-up earlier for the equally funny, The Jerk.
